Plus it reminds me of our vacation in Maui and the CD from the Road to Hana. Has anyone else ever done that trip? If not I highly suggest it! You’ll see mixed reviews mostly because it is a long day in the car, but we loved it. Especially as a nice relaxing day to just be together. Though it’s not recommended if you’re renting a large SUV because the road is pretty narrow.

Make sure you go early enough (or plan to stay the night along the way) to spend time at the black sand beach (our favorite!) Waianapanapa and soak in the Pools of Oheo while the sun is still out.
